WebApr 25, 2024 · Of the 247 million U.S. citizens who profess to be Christians, only 1.5 million tithe. That’s less than 1%. As a society, we’re a little better. But the average American still only gives about 2% of their income to charity every year. It’s a shame that we as Christians are below the average when it comes to giving. Webv. t. e. Tzedakah or Ṣedaqah ( Hebrew: צדקה [ts (e)daˈka]) is a Hebrew word meaning "righteousness", but commonly used to signify charity. [1] This concept of "charity" differs from the modern Western understanding of "charity".
